I searched the mailing list for a message that is showing on my mail.err log file. I did "postcat msg | clamscan -" and it took a lot to scan it, an hour. What is odd is that the message saved at /var/spool/amavis/tmp/ is 9.8M (du -sh on the dir), but clamscan said it scanned 19M. No viruses found. I tried setting "ArchiveMaxFileSize" on /etc/clamd.conf to 8M, so this message would be sent without being scanned(?), stop Postfix, Amavis, Clamd, restarted them, but didn't work. The message was scanned again, and it stopped with the same message on /var/log/mail.err.
Is there a way to free the message, I mean, let it be sent, without being scanned?
